Transaction 25c9462241f15b392094547278a8805920d5d6c7d97f8b943f65467413efe412
2 Input
2 Outputs
- 25c9462241f15b392094547278a8805920d5d6c7d97f8b943f65467413efe412:0
- 25c9462241f15b392094547278a8805920d5d6c7d97f8b943f65467413efe412:1
value 443074
address 1Bq5DkBbgzF5pLieessCM5Dum2g7Rpj1nk
value 4712046
address 3KPCU3MR69dKvQUhVAC5uGtfU2NNAMQ59Z